Garden Border Replacement in Citrus County, FL
Garden border replacement services involve removing and upgrading existing garden borders to enhance the appearance and functionality of outdoor spaces. This service covers a variety of projects, including replacing worn-out or damaged edging, updating flower bed boundaries, and installing new borders made from materials such as stone, brick, or wood. Property owners often seek this service to create a more defined landscape, prevent soil erosion, or simply refresh the look of their garden beds and borders.
Before requesting garden border replacement, homeowners typically want to understand the different material options available, the scope of work involved, and how the new borders will integrate with existing landscaping. It’s also helpful to consider the overall style of the property and any specific maintenance preferences. Clarifying these details can ensure the project aligns with the desired aesthetic and functional outcomes for the outdoor space.

Garden Border Replacement Questions
What are garden border replacement services? They involve removing old or damaged borders and installing new edging to define garden beds and pathways.
Why should property owners consider replacing garden borders? Replacing borders can improve garden appearance, prevent soil erosion, and enhance overall landscape structure.
What types of materials are used for garden borders? Common options include stone, brick, plastic, metal, and wood, chosen based on style and durability preferences.
When is the best time to replace garden borders? It is typically done during mild weather seasons when soil conditions are suitable for installation and landscaping work.
